Grybauskaite and Gurria discussed Lithuania’s OECD accession

Petras Vaida, BC, Vilnius, 22.01.2015.Print version
President of Lithuania Dalia Grybauskaite, currently attending the World Economic Forum in Davos, met with Angel Gurria, Secretary-General of the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D). The meeting focused on Lithuania's progress towards negotiations for membership in this prestigious organization, reported BC presidential press service.

Lithuania expects to be invited to start its OECD accession negotiations this year. Decision on opening talks is likely to be adopted in June, after assessment of Lithuania's homework and implementation of the membership action plan.

 

According to the President, membership in one of the most influential organisations in the world would be an important international recognition of Lithuania and a new opportunity to better protect its own interests as well as participate in global decision-making.

 

"It will not only boost Lithuania's international standing, but will also bring substantial benefits to our economy and people. Lithuania will become more attractive for foreign investors, improve its credit ratings and borrowing costs," the President said.

 

Our country is already an active participant in OECD committees and working groups. Lithuanian representatives cooperate with OECD experts in strengthening competition, promoting economic liberalization and fighting corruption. Lithuania also contributes to the organisation's support project in Ukraine.
